1. Spain: A Blend of Culture, Coastlines, and Sunshine
Spain has long been regarded as a destination where family travel is made effortless through its diverse landscapes, warm climate, and cultural richness. A welcoming atmosphere is created along the coastlines of Costa del Sol and Costa Brava, where child-friendly resorts, beaches, and water activities are commonly enjoyed. In urban centres such as Barcelona and Madrid, a wide range of educational and recreational experiences is offered, from aquariums and museums to lively plazas and architectural marvels. The country’s renowned gastronomy, seasonal festivities, and efficient transportation network further contribute to its appeal, ensuring that families experience convenience along with cultural discovery. The combination of comfort, entertainment, and outdoor leisure makes Spain a dependable choice for a well-rounded international holiday.
2. Tokyo, Japan: A Meeting Point of Tradition and Technology
In Tokyo, a harmonious balance between modern innovation and deep-rooted cultural traditions has been created, making it an exciting destination for families from around the world. Tokyo Disneyland and DisneySea continue to be regarded as major attractions where creativity and themed entertainment are presented on a grand scale. Throughout the city, safety, cleanliness, and navigability are prioritised, making movement with children especially convenient. Ancient temples, bustling markets, futuristic districts, and interactive museums provide opportunities for learning and exploration, while the city’s efficient public transport ensures ease of travel. Tokyo’s unique blend of old and new makes it an ideal destination for families seeking a dynamic yet structured holiday experience.
3. Bali, Indonesia: A Tropical Escape for Relaxation and Discovery
Bali has earned global recognition as one of the most accessible and budget-friendly island destinations for families. Known for its lush terrains, scenic beaches, and vibrant cultural traditions, the island offers numerous resorts designed specifically for family comfort. Kids clubs, activity-based programs, and recreational pools are regularly provided, ensuring that younger travellers remain engaged throughout their stay. Families often choose to visit destinations such as the Sacred Monkey Forest Sanctuary, cascading waterfalls, serene temples, and cultural dance performances, all of which allow children to immerse themselves in a new environment. Affordable dining, hospitable communities, and a relaxed pace contribute to Bali’s reputation as a stress-free vacation spot for families seeking both adventure and tranquillity.
4. London, United Kingdom: A Hub of Learning and Entertainment
London has consistently been acknowledged as a destination where education and recreation are seamlessly integrated. Visitors are encouraged to explore world-famous landmarks such as the Tower of London, the London Eye, and the Natural History Museum, all of which provide insight into history, culture, and science. The city’s parks, including Hyde Park and Regent’s Park, create open spaces for picnics, playtime, and leisurely walks. Theatre productions, interactive museums, and hands-on scientific exhibits make learning enjoyable for children, while the city’s efficient transportation system allows families to navigate comfortably. The blend of structure, culture, and child-friendly activities makes London an enduring favourite among family travellers.
5. Dubai, United Arab Emirates: A Modern Playground of Luxury and Adventure
Dubai has been shaped into one of the world’s most modern family-oriented destinations, offering a combination of luxury, themed entertainment, and cultural experiences. Attractions such as IMG Worlds of Adventure, pristine shoreline resorts, desert safaris, and the Dubai Mall’s impressive aquarium continue to be favoured by families. Indoor attractions, including skating rinks and themed zones, allow visitors to enjoy activities regardless of weather conditions. Dubai’s reputation for safety, world-class hospitality, and high-quality accommodation further enhances its suitability for families seeking an exciting yet comfortable vacation.
6. Sydney, Australia: An Outdoor Haven Filled With Scenic Adventures
Sydney offers an environment where outdoor exploration, scenic landscapes, and family-friendly attractions are emphasised. Bondi Beach, Taronga Zoo, and the Sydney Opera House remain iconic spots frequently visited by travellers. The city is known for its coastal walks, sprawling parks, and playgrounds that encourage active engagement for both children and adults. Pleasant weather conditions throughout much of the year contribute to a relaxed atmosphere, making Sydney ideal for families who value open spaces, nature, and recreational opportunities.
